5. • John MT, Slade GD et al 2005 did a study
sought to investigate problems reported by
patients before and after prosthodontic
treatment. They concluded that the number
of problems decreased substantially after
prosthodontic treatment. Fixed partial
dentures more effectively influenced the
problems reported before treatment than did
removable partial or complete dentures.
www.indiandentalacademy.com
6. • Roessler DM et al. 2003 Before treatment
even begins, the patient's motivation for
denture treatment and emotional attitude
towards dentures must be evaluated.
Patients will thereby gain realistic
expectations of what can and cannot be
achieved, and dentists will understand what
the patient really wants. Finally, patients
must be informed that continued success
depends on regular denture maintenance at
home combined with periodic consultation
with the dentist
www.indiandentalacademy.com
7. • Dervis E. et al 2002 did a study to
investigate relationships between patient
complaints with complete dentures and
several factors such as age, gender,
medical status and denture faults. Six
hundred patients who received new
dentures were assessed three months after
insertion of the dentures.
www.indiandentalacademy.com
8. • No significant relationship was found when
age, gender, and medical status were
compared with patient complaints.
Statistically significant relationships were
observed between denture construction
faults or the condition of the patient's
denture bearing mucosa and patient
complaints.
www.indiandentalacademy.com
9. • Yoshida M, Sato Y, Akagawa Y. 2001 did a
study on the correlation between the quality
of life (QOL), defined as overall satisfaction
with daily life, and denture satisfaction in
elderly complete denture wearers and
concluded that edentulous elderly people
who are well satisfied with their daily lives
are also satisfied with their complete
dentures.
www.indiandentalacademy.com
10. • Albert A.M. et al 1997 did a study on the
concept “prosthetic condition”, which
combines the quality of complete dentures
and residual alveolar ridges. They
concluded that . Logistic regression analysis
demonstrated that no variable of the
“prosthetic condition” proved to explain the
denture satisfaction. Some variables of the
“prosthetic condition” had a significant but
not relevant correlation with some denture
complaints.
www.indiandentalacademy.com
11. • Muller F et al, 1995 did a study on Studies
on adaptation to complete dentures. The aim
of the study was to evaluate the oral
stereognosis and tactile sensibility in
edentate subjects and relate these to patient
age and capability of adaptation to new
prostheses. In conclusion, the results cannot
support a relationship between high oral
stereognosis and adaptation problems.
However, good denture retention facilitates
the adaptation process.
www.indiandentalacademy.com
12. • Champion H et al in 1995 investigated into
the problems experienced by 114 referred
patients with complete dentures who were
considered to be difficult or to have difficult
prosthodontic problems. The commonest
problems were those of pain and lack of
retention, mainly due to occlusal
discrepancies and excessive VDO.
www.indiandentalacademy.com
13. • Treatment was carried out on an individual
basis with a large proportion of dentures
being remade. However, a small number
was satisfied by counseling alone without
procedural treatment. The overall success
rate for treatment was 80 per cent.
www.indiandentalacademy.com
14. • Basker RM, Beck CB, et al 1993 did a
survey of the dissatisfied denture patient. In
this study a wide range of tests was applied
to complete denture wearers attending for
treatment at Leeds Dental School, including
an extensive interview and questionnaire,
clinical examination and a personality
assessment. In the majority of cases
technical errors in denture construction
accounted for the presenting complaint. It
was not possible to identify a factor or group
of factors common to those patients who had

15. Problems and treatments
• It is impossible to discuss every complaint
which may be made by a patient but the
following are the most common and will
give a comprehensive outline of how the
dentist may diagnose their causes and
how they should be treated
www.indiandentalacademy.com
16. Most complaints will fall under one of the
following headings, although frequently a patient
will have more than one complaint:
1 Pain and discomfort.
2 Appearance.
3 Inability to eat.
4 Lack of retention and instability. .
5 Clicking of teeth.
6 Nausea.
7 Inability to tolerate dentures.
8 Altered speech.
9 Biting the cheek and tongue.
10 Food under the denture.

18. Over-extension of the periphery
• This is by far the most common cause of pain
with new dentures.
• It is due to incorrect moulding of the
impression or incorrect outlining of the
denture on the cast and is visible in the
mouth as an area of hyperemia or an ulcer,
depending upon how continuously the
denture has been worn, or how gross is the
over-extension.
www.indiandentalacademy.com
19. Treatment:
• Apply pressure-indicating paste to the
periphery and insert the denture. On removal
an area of wipe-off will be seen.
www.indiandentalacademy.com
20. • An alternative method is to dry the mucosa,
touch the inflamed area with methylene blue
or an indelible pencil and insert the denture.
• Remove the denture and ease the
periphery with a small carborundum stone or
a bur except in cases of severe ulceration
this will give immediate relief, but remember
that the area is slightly edematous and
therefore only the minimum material should
be removed from the denture.
www.indiandentalacademy.com
21. • If the denture is an old one, the over-
extension may be due to alveolar resorption
and the slow, chronic irritation may have
caused a local hyperpla-sia. Cut back the
denture periphery and line the fitting
surface with tissue conditioner or black
gutta percha.
• When the hyperplasia has reduced, or been
removed surgically, construct new dentures
www.indiandentalacademy.com
22. Poor fit
• This is easily detected by the poor
retention, rocking, tilting and inability to
seat the denture accurately in any
position.
• The movement of the denture rubbing the
mucosa causes pain, and patches of
redness are sometimes visible.
www.indiandentalacademy.com
23. • Treatment: New dentures, but the old
ones can be worn in the meantime with a
lining of tissue
www.indiandentalacademy.com
24. Insufficient relief
• This may occur over a prominent bony area,
such as the buccal canine region where the
bone has been expanded at the time of
extraction. The denture moves over the hard
area causing pain. The painful area is red
and possibly ulcerated.
www.indiandentalacademy.com
25. • Treatment: apply pressure indicating
paste to demarcate the area and ease the
contact surface with a carborundum stone.
www.indiandentalacademy.com
26. Occlusal Faults
• Wrong antero-posterior relationship
When the teeth occlude the mandible will
not be fully retruded. Attempts to retrude it
will drag the dentures against the mucosa as
they are locked together by the interdigitation
of the teeth. This is often difficult to diagnose
but can be seen by watching closely while
the patient slowly approximates the teeth
and increases the occlusal load.www.indiandentalacademy.com
27. • At some stage in this movement the lower
denture will be seen to shift. This is often
associated with a complaint of looseness.
• Treatment: if only slight it can be cured by a
check record, remounting and grinding of
the dentures; if gross, place occlusal pivots
to reposition the lower denture
www.indiandentalacademy.com
28. Occlusal Faults: Uneven pressure
• This may be the result of faulty setting of the
teeth and, if so, is usually very slight.
• More commonly it is the result of tilting of the
record blocks, undetected at the trial stage.
• Pain is due to trauma caused by the one-
sided pressure and is then confined to the
crest of the alveolar ridge on that side;
sometimes small hyper keratinized areas are
to be seen, as in an excessive vertical
dimension.
www.indiandentalacademy.com
29. • Diagnosis can be made by trying to insert a
thin blade between the posterior teeth, first
on one side, and then on the other, with the
teeth in firm contact.
• Lesser degrees of error can be detected by
inserting a thin mylar strip on either side
between the occlusal surfaces of the
posterior teeth while the patient closes just
sufficiently to hold them in place.
• The strip on the side of the heavy pressure
will be immovable while that on the opposite
side will be easily withdrawn.
www.indiandentalacademy.com
30. • Treatment: if the error is small the areas of
heavy contact are detected by marking
paper and the fault corrected by grinding or,
better still, by remounting with a check
record and adjusting the occlusion on the
articulator.
• If the error is large, temporary improvement
can be effected by adding cold-cure acrylic
to the side of lighter pressure. When
symptoms reduces either replace the
posterior teeth or remake the dentures.
www.indiandentalacademy.com
31. Occlusal Faults: Excessive vertical
dimension
• This is due to an error at the registration stage
and it is almost always due to increasing the
vertical height beyond normal limits.
• Pain is associated with the crest of the lower
ridge, as distinct from the lateral surfaces, and
small white patches may be seen in the painful
area.
• Easing the denture over these white patches
gives immediate relief from pain, but within a few
days the patient usually returns with the same
complaint in a different site.www.indiandentalacademy.com
32. • In nearly all cases of excessive height the
patient also complains that the teeth jar,
clatter, are 'in the way' or 'too high' when
eating, and sometimes when talking.
• Treatment: if the occlusal plane of the upper
is judged to be correct make a new lower
denture to a decreased vertical dimension;
otherwise, new upper and lower dentures.
www.indiandentalacademy.com
33. Occlusal Faults: Insufficient vertical
dimension
• Pain from this cause is not normally
associated with new dentures.
• It is almost always the result of loss of
vertical height through alveolar resorption.
• The pain is often indefinite in locality and
may be associated with temporo-mandibular
joint dysfunction and
its symptoms of facial
or joint pain.
www.indiandentalacademy.com
34. • Treatment - is aimed at restoring the
vertical height and stabilizing the occlusion
by occlusal pivots, followed by new
dentures.
www.indiandentalacademy.com
35. Occlusal Cuspal interference
• A dragging action will be exerted on both
upper and lower dentures during all lateral
and protrusive movements with the teeth in
contact if cusped posterior teeth are used :
– With a plane-line articulator.
– With a moving-condyle articulator if care has not
been taken to obtain balanced articulation.
• The same effect may result from an
excessive vertical overlap or an incorrect
incisal guidance angle.
www.indiandentalacademy.com
36. • This dragging will cause pain with well-fitting
dentures and also instability with those
having poor retention.
• The pain is usually widely distributed and
often only experienced when attempting to
eat, although 'empty mouth' grinding
movements exacerbate the problem.
• Sore areas may be found on the labial or
buccal surfaces of the alveolar ridges, and
on the lingual surfaces of the lower ridge.
www.indiandentalacademy.com
37. • The patient often removes the dentures after
a few hours because of the discomfort.
• This condition can easily be detected by
asking the patient to grind the teeth, when
shifting of the dentures can be seen.
• Another simple method of diagnosing this
fault is to hold the upper denture in place
between the finger and thumb above the
canine teeth and ask the patient to grind the
teeth." The dragging can easily be felt.
www.indiandentalacademy.com
38. • Treatment: If the cuspal interference is
slight, or confined to only one or two teeth, it
can be corrected by the careful use of
marking paper and grinding.
• The taking of a check record and adjusting
the occlusal surfaces on the articulator is the
most accurate method of correcting this
error. If the interference is gross, new
dentures with balanced
occlusion will be required.
www.indiandentalacademy.com
39. Teeth off the ridge
• Pain from this cause is confined chiefly to the
upper buccal sulci and maxillary tuberosities.
• It is usually the result of setting the upper
teeth too far buccally in an attempt to
overcome marked discrepancies between the
size of the upper arch and that of the lower,
combined with lack of peripheral seal and
incorrectly shaped polished surfaces.
www.indiandentalacademy.com
40. • During mastication the upper denture tilts,
digging the periphery of the denture into the
mucosa on the working side and pulling it
down over the tuberosity, or other undercut
area, on the opposite side.
• The actual tilting can be seen if the patient
bites on a wooden
spatula placed on
the posterior teeth,
first on one side
and then the other.
www.indiandentalacademy.com
41. • Treatment:
Some relief may be obtained by
removing all four last molars and reducing
the bulk of base acrylic over the
tuberosity. This gives more space for the
tongue to control the upper denture. New
dentures with the above faults corrected,
are the most effective treatment.
www.indiandentalacademy.com
42. Retained root or Unerupted tooth
• Pain may be caused by direct pressure on an
area which is already tender and will be felt very
soon after inserting new dentures.
• It may also be caused by a well-fitting denture
preventing draining from an undetected sinus.
• Well-fitting, functional dentures appear in some
cases to stimulate the eruption of unerupted
teeth.
• The painful area will usually be localized and
often close inspection will reveal the cause.
www.indiandentalacademy.com
43. • Diagnosis should be confirmed by
radiograph.
• Treatment:
Extraction of the root or tooth followed
by relining of that part of the denture. If for
some reason extraction is contraindicated,
then relief may be given by easing the
denture over the area.
www.indiandentalacademy.com
44. Narrow Resorbed Ridge
• This is more usually associated with the
lower, and caused by the denture pressing
the mucosa against the sharp ridge of bone
during mastication.
www.indiandentalacademy.com
45. • The pain is worst on the side habitually
used for eating, but it may be widespread
with an associated burning sensation.
• It is most severe during, and immediately
following, a meal, and is increased by
perseverance on the part of the patient.
www.indiandentalacademy.com
46. • Treatment: in the lower, alveolectomy
followed by relining the denture may be
considered but relief over the bony
irregularities is often the best treatment.
• In the upper, relief over the crest of the
alveolus is usually sufficient since the
palate can resist the masticatory loads
www.indiandentalacademy.com
47. Mental foramen
• Under normal conditions the mental foramen is
situated on the buccal surface of the mandible
below the lower alveolar ridge and is thus
outside the denture-bearing area.
• If, however, gross resorption of the alveolar
and basal bone has taken place, the foramen
may come to lie on the crest of the ridge and
so be subject to pressure from the denture.
www.indiandentalacademy.com
48. • When a new denture is constructed to these
altered conditions, adequate relief should be
given for the mental nerve.
• The pain may be localized to the immediate
vicinity of the mental foramen, or it may be
referred, and is then felt as a pain in the side
of the face or in the lips and chin.
• It can usually be diagnosed by locating the
mental foramen by radiograph.
• Treatment: relieve the denture so that the
nerve cannot be subjected to pressure
www.indiandentalacademy.com
49. Irregular resorption
• Sometimes, because' of alveolar resorption,
an area is found which is rough, with a
number of sharp spicules of bone, and if the
mucosa covering it is thin, pain will be
caused by pressure on it.
• This is very similar to the pain associated
with narrow resorbed ridges except that it is
localized.
www.indiandentalacademy.com
50. • The uneven alveolus can be detected by
gentle palpation and confirmed by
radiograph.
• Treatment: surgical smoothing of the
affected area followed by relining the
denture. Treatment by surgery in such cases
is often disappointing as the area remains
tender for a long time and so simply
relieving the denture may be a better
treatment
www.indiandentalacademy.com
51. Rough contact or fitting surface
• If a denture has been processed on a cast
with a porous surface small pimples or blebs
will be found on the contact surface where
the acrylic has been forced into the small air
bubbles of the cast.
• Normally these pimples are removed by the
technician, but if they are overlooked the
patient will complain of pain under pressure
and a local area of inflammation can be
seen.
www.indiandentalacademy.com
52. • Treatment: remove the roughness from
the denture and polish lightly. Always
inspect a denture when it is dry, under a
good light and magnification, to detect
surface roughness or blebs.
www.indiandentalacademy.com
53. Swallowing and sore throat
• These two complaints are listed together as
they are different ways of describing pain
arising from the over-extension of a denture.
• The cause in the upper is extension on to the
soft palate with trauma in the post-dam
region or excessive pressure in the hamular
notches, while in the lower it is over-
extension distally in the lingual pouch.
• The pain ceases if the denture is left out, and
starts again soon after its reinsertion.
www.indiandentalacademy.com
54. • Treatment:
The patient will usually know which
denture is at fault and examination of the
regions described will show a slight redness
or ulceration.
Reduction of the over-extension
produces relief, although the symptoms may
persist for some time
www.indiandentalacademy.com
55. Undercuts
• Sometimes the dentist will make use of an
undercut area which, in his judgment, is
unlikely to cause pain, and although the new
denture was inserted with comfort, the
patient returns with the complaint that
inserting and removing the denture is
becoming increasingly painful.
• The maximum bulge of the alveolus in this
area is found to be red and painful, and in
some cases ulcerated.
www.indiandentalacademy.com
56. • Treatment:
It may be possible to insert this side of the
denture first, quite painlessly, and then the
opposite side, removing it in reverse order.
If this maneuvering is not successful the fitting
surface must be cut away until the denture can be
inserted comfortably but the periphery must not be
reduced in height. Often the flange will be too thin
to allow acrylic to be removed from the fitting
surface and if this is so the flange must be
thickened by the addition of more material. Should
this easing ruin the retention, as is likely to be the
case if much has to be cut away, an alveolectomy
will be necessary followed by a new buccal or
labial flange.

59. Appearance
• In spite of the greatest care on the part of the
dentist to obtain the patient's full approval of the
appearance at the trial stage, there will always be
some patients who are dissatisfied with their
appearance when wearing the finished dentures.
• The patient should not be condemned too severely
for this inconsistency, as it is difficult to form a
considered opinion on all details of facial
appearance when sitting in a dental chair, in
strange surroundings, with trial dentures in the
mouth, and being asked to criticize the work of a
professional person.
www.indiandentalacademy.com
61. • The number of patients who. are dissatisfied with
their appearance with the final dentures can be
much reduced if the dentist insists on a relation or
candid friend being present at the trial stage,
although it has to be stressed that the appearance
cannot be fully assessed until four to six weeks
after insertion of the finished dentures.
• This is because of the adaptation of the lip and
facial muscles to the underlying teeth and denture
bases.
• This is the basis of the problem of judging the
appearance at the trial stage.
www.indiandentalacademy.com
62. Facial appearance
• Patients may complain that the nose and chin
are more prominent or are approximating.
• This is due, in the case of old dentures the
patient is wearing, to continuing alveolar
resorption and the spatial change of position
of the dentures in relation to the skull as a
whole.
• If this complaint is voiced after delivery of the
new dentures it means a failure to restore the
occlusal face height correctly.
www.indiandentalacademy.com
63. • The same causes operate in complaints of
the lips and cheeks falling in, although this
is more likely to be due to the teeth of new
dentures being set too far lingually and to
insufficient width of the buccal and labial
flanges.
www.indiandentalacademy.com
64. Dissatisfaction with teeth Colour
• This complaint is almost invariably that the
teeth are too dark or too yellow, but before
changing them it must be explained to the
patient that natural teeth darken with age
and that very lightshaded teeth look more
artificial than darker ones.
• Treatment: comply if possible with the
patient's request for lighter teeth, usually by
a compromise between the shade chosen
by the operator and that chosen by the
patient.
www.indiandentalacademy.com
65. Shape
• Few people are sufficiently observant to be able to
describe the shape of their lost teeth and are likely
to say vaguely, when referring to their dentures, that
'they don't look right'.
• Shape is closely bound up with size, and a different
make of tooth of the same basic shape and size
may well look more natural.
• Artificial teeth usually look larger than natural teeth
of identical size, probably because their mesial and
distal surfaces are not so rounded, and so the eye
is. able to focus on their width more accurately.
www.indiandentalacademy.com
66. General dissatisfaction
• One of the most difficult cases to deal with is that of
the patient, fitted with new dentures, who returns a
few days later with the vague remark that he 'does
not like them'.
• He can specify no particular complaint and it will be
found on questioning that comfort, retention,
stability and efficiency are not at fault; so the
conclusion, which is invariably right, is that it is a
question of appearance.
• It may be due to diffidence on the part of the patient
unwilling to make a specific complaint that would
appear to criticize the dentist's skill.
www.indiandentalacademy.com
67. Inability to eat
• This complaint is mainly confined to patients
who are wearing complete dentures for the first
time, and are impatient at the time spent in.
acquiring new habits of eating.
• Careful attention by the operator to the
psychological approach to denture wearing, will
eliminate this complaint except in rare cases,
and these must be persuaded to persevere, so
that they will either learn anew how to eat or will
define some specific complaint which can then
be remedied.
www.indiandentalacademy.com
68. • Difficulty may be encountered with certain fibrous
foods and this is likely to be due to lowcusp or
zerocusp posterior teeth, lack of interdigitation of
posterior teeth, the use of acrylic teeth in a patient
used to porcelain, unbalanced occlusion, or a
locked occlusion arising from setting teeth on a
planeline articulator.
• These faults may also cause the dentures to
dislodge during eating, a further complication being
a restricted tongue space which may occur if the
upper teeth are set directly over the ridge, if the
lower posterior teeth overhang the tongue or if the
posterior teeth, particularly the lowers, are too
broad.
www.indiandentalacademy.com
69. • The posterior natural teeth are often lost
some time before the anterior ones, with
the result that a habit is formed of eating on
the anterior teeth. When complete dentures
are being worn for the first time, it is only
natural that the patient should try to
continue his previous eating habits with bad
results.
www.indiandentalacademy.com
70. Lack of retention and instability
• When opening the mouth patients more often
complain that the lower denture lifts than that the
upper one drops.
• If this lifting only occurs when the mouth is
widely opened it may be explained by what is
commonly known as a low tongue position.
• When a dentate person opens the mouth wide
the tongue remains back in the mouth to protect
the oropharyngeal isthmus while in an
experienced denture wearer the tongue falls
forward to stabilize the lower denture.
www.indiandentalacademy.com
71. • If the low tongue position persists in
edentulousness then the denture is likely to
rise on wide mouth opening. Explanation of
this will help the patient to counteract the
problem.
Other causes are given below.
Over-extension
This has already been discussed under the
heading of pain, the difference in these
cases being that the overextension is so
slight that the tissues do not make constant
contact with it, and consequently soreness
does not arise.
www.indiandentalacademy.com
72. Tight lips
• These can be a most difficult problem when in
conjunction with a flat, atrophic lower. The
inward pressure from the lips will seat the
upper denture more firmly in position but will
push the lower denture backwards and up the
ascending ramus.
www.indiandentalacademy.com
73. • Treatment: Remake with the lower anterior
teeth set more lingually, with a labial
concavity on the denture, and with the
maximum extension in the region of the
retromolar pads. Denture space techniques
are useful and surgical vestibuloplasty
must be considered.
www.indiandentalacademy.com
74. • Tongue space If the lower posterior teeth
are tilted or set lingually they produce an
undercut area into which the wide middle
third of thy tongue will press. Movements of
the tongue then lift the denture.
www.indiandentalacademy.com
75. • Treatment: reduce the width of the lower
posterior teeth by grinding off the lingual
cusps. This effectively alters the
downward facing lingual surface to an
upward facing one more favourable to
tongue control
www.indiandentalacademy.com
76. Under-extension and lack of peripheral seal
• This fault is by no means uncommon, and its
effect on the retention of the denture is most
marked. Maximum retention cannot be
obtained without covering the greatest
possible denturebearing area.
• Some clinicians produce this fault by placing
excessive tension on the soft tissues during
the peripheral moulding of the impression,
through their desire to avoid overextension.
www.indiandentalacademy.com
77. • Where this cause is suspected of being
the fault, it can be checked by adding
tracing stick round the periphery, moulding
it carefully and noting the result. A
conventional reline can then be
undertaken
www.indiandentalacademy.com
78. • Lack of saliva There is no specific
treatment for this condition but palliative
treatment such as artificial saliva will help the
patient
• When coughing or sneezing Occasionally
a new denture wearer will complain that his
upper denture falls and his lower denture
lifts, whenever he coughs or sneezes
violently.
www.indiandentalacademy.com
79. • Treatment: it must be explained to the
patient that when coughing or sneezing the
soft palate rises suddenly and there is a
moment when the pressure of air in the
mouth is considerable so that the peripheral
seal of the upper denture is broken and it is
liable to fall; the unusual muscular
movement causes the lower denture to lift.
There is no way of preventing these
movements of the dentures, but covering the
mouth with a hand or handkerchief is an
obvious suggestion
www.indiandentalacademy.com
80. Clicking of teeth
Patients are often less disturbed by contact of
teeth than relatives who are irritated by the
noise. The main causes are:
1. Excessive vertical height causes the
dentures to contact during speech,
particularly the sibilant sounds, as the
mandible moves vertically through the
speaking space
www.indiandentalacademy.com
81. 2. Movement of the lower denture from whatever
cause is very liable to lead to clicking of the
teeth, particularly the molars if the distal part of
the denture rises
3. Cuspal interference or lack of balanced
occlusion is a likely cause of faulty tooth
contacts. Particular attention should be paid to
the retruded contact position as faults here are
often missed in the examination of the
occlusion.
www.indiandentalacademy.com
82. 4. Porcelain teeth by nature of the material
create more impact noise than acrylic; a
problem increased if the patient has been
used to acrylic for many years.
www.indiandentalacademy.com
83. Nausea
• It is because of light or intermittent contact on the
soft palate or back of the tongue, and the patient's
complaint is almost invariably 'that the upper
denture goes too far back and makes me feel sick'.
The causes are given below.
1. Denture slightly over-extended Movements of
the soft palate cause intermittent contact with the
denture and this may be diagnosed by observing
the relation of the posterior border to the vibrating
line.
Treatment: remove the excess and readapt the
postdam if necessary.
www.indiandentalacademy.com
84. 2. Denture under-extended: If the posterior
border of the upper denture does not
extend beyond the hard palate it cannot
compress the soft tissues sufficiently to
maintain close contact under all normal
conditions, and this will often cause nausea
because of the intermittent contact and
tickling effect at the back of the palate. A
posterior edge which lies too far: forward is
detected by the dorsum of the tongue and is
a common cause of nausea.
www.indiandentalacademy.com
85. 3. Thick posterior border This is a very
common cause of nausea resulting from
the dorsum of the tongue being irritated by
the thick edge. The edge of the upper
denture should be thin, and slightly
embedded in the compressed mucosa, so
that the tongue is unable to detect any
definite junction between denture and
palatal mucosa
www.indiandentalacademy.com
86. 4. Protrusive imbalance If the occlusion is
not balanced "in protrusive imbalance
there is a heavy contact on the incisors
and no contact between the molars. This
produces movement of the back of the
upper denture which causes saliva to
collect at the posterior border and a
tickling effect, leading to nausea.
www.indiandentalacademy.com
87. Inability to tolerate dentures
• Patients sometimes complain that new
dentures are not comfortable but can give
no specific cause for complaint. These
cases are difficult to diagnose since they
are not accompanied by pain, and
retention appears to be satisfactory, but as
the patient has nearly always previously
worn dentures a careful comparison of the
new with the old will generally give a clue
to the cause.
www.indiandentalacademy.com
88. 1. Cramped tongue space This is the most
common reason for this complaint, the
teeth on the new upper denture having
been set on the crest of the alveolar ridge
which has resorbed considerably since the
older denture was made. Since the
resorption is greatest on the buccal and
labial aspects of the upper ridge, the teeth
are now mounted
nearer to the midline,
so decreasing the
tongue space.www.indiandentalacademy.com
89. 2. Altered occlusal plane As in the case
of an altered vertical height, the position
of the occlusal plane is unlikely to have
been changed by more than a few
millimetres, but even a slight alteration
will require some adjustment of muscular
movement and control, particularly the
tongue.
www.indiandentalacademy.com
90. 3. Unemployed ridge This type of ridge is
a common cause of discomfort and
inability to wear a new complete lower
denture because the latter applies
pressure on tissue not previously loaded.
www.indiandentalacademy.com
91. 4. Changes in shape Very often when new dentures
are made with marked changes in form and
dimension of the periphery or polished surface as
compared with the patient's existing dentures there
is difficulty in tolerating the change, particularly in
older patients.
• Treatment: unless any of the above-mentioned
factors are gross the patient should be encouraged
to persevere for several weeks, by which time, in
most cases, the discomfort or intolerance will have
disappeared; if not, then nothing remains but to
modify the dentures or remake them if the cause of
the problem has been diagnosed.
www.indiandentalacademy.com
92. Altered speech
• When complete dentures are first worn there is
always some temporary alteration in speech
owing to the thickness of the denture covering the
palate, necessitating slightly altered positions of
the tongue. Commonly this is only a temporary
inconvenience, most rapidly overcome by the
patient reading aloud; when there is an altered
position of the upper incisors, a change in their
palatal shape, any reduction of tongue space, or
alteration in occlusal level, adaptation may be
very difficult even with perseverance.
www.indiandentalacademy.com
93. • Treatment: the dentures must be remade
paying particular attention to the principles
and to the correct restoration of the
denture space, defined as the space in the
edentulous mouth formerly occupied by
the teeth and supporting tissues which
have since been lost.
www.indiandentalacademy.com
94. Cheek biting
1. Insufficient ovetjet
2. Reduced vertical height
1. Insufficient ovetjet The normal occlusal
relationship of the posterior teeth is with
the buccal cusps of the upper teeth
outside those of the lower teeth; this
arrangement, along with the correct
peripheral width on the dentures,
normally prevents the cheeks getting
caught between the teeth..www.indiandentalacademy.com
95. • If for any reason this arrangement has
been altered, or if a patient has very lax
cheeks, cheek biting may occur
• Treatment: Increase the buccal overjet
and make sure the peripheral form is
adequate in width and height. In some
cases it may be necessary to remove the
last molar teeth or grind the buccal
surfaces of the teeth
www.indiandentalacademy.com
96. 2. Reduced vertical height If the vertical
occlusal dimension of the dentures is
reduced, the resultant bunching of the
cheeks allows them to be trapped between
the occlusal surfaces of the teeth as they
occlude. This may also occur if the occlusal
plane of either denture is' incorrectly
positioned.
www.indiandentalacademy.com
97. It should be remembered that when the
natural teeth are lost there is no record
of the occlusal position of either the
upper or lower teeth and the selection of
the occlusal plane in complete dentures
is entirely empiric.
Treatment: restore the vertical dimension
or change the occlusal plane
www.indiandentalacademy.com
98. • Biting the tongue This is almost
invariably due to a decrease in the tongue
space occurring when fitting new dentures
for patients already wearing dentures, but
it may also be due to changes in occlusal
level as mentioned above
www.indiandentalacademy.com
99. Food under the denture
• This complaint is usually made by patients
wearing dentures for the first time and who have
not yet learnt how best to control the food.
Undoubtedly a perfect peripheral seal will prevent
the ingress of food beneath the denture, but
perfection is not always attained and, owing to
alveolar resorption, never maintained. Scraping a
groove on the cast, along and near the entire
periphery of the denture, is sometimes carried out,
but this food-line, as it is termed, causes
inflammation and ulceration and should not be
undertaken www.indiandentalacademy.com
100. • Treatment: this usually consists of covering
the maximum possible area and obtaining an
adequate peripheral seal; thereafter, only
perseverance by the patient can bring about
any improvement.
www.indiandentalacademy.com
101. Inability to keep denture clean
• This complaint may be caused by:
1. Inadequate laboratory work by the
technician, especially failure to polish all
round each tooth before setting in wax.
Careless waxing and flasking are common
faults. It is not possible to polish acrylic in
the interdental space, or the col between
teeth, if the original wax was rough or
incorrectly designed.
2. Loss of original polish by patient's use of
hard household abrasives.

103. 3. Failure of patient to clean the dentures
regularly or efficiently. Many denture patients
also wear spectacles but often the dentures
are cleaned in the bathroom under poor light
when the spectacles are not worn. Cleaning
is therefore not always done properly.
www.indiandentalacademy.com
104. 4. Incorrect use of denture cleansers. These
cleansers may be listed:
(a) Oxygenating cleansers containing alkaline
percarbonates or peroxides.
(b) Hypochlorite solutions containing dilute
sodium hypochlorite.
(c) Mineral acid, usually dilute hydrochloric acid
(d) Powders and pastes containing mild
abrasives, precipitated chalk or hydrated
alumi-na.
(e) Liquid detergent.

111. Summary and Conclusion
• At the conclusion it is worth stressing the
eight most common causes of problems
with complete dentures:
1. Incorrect antero-posterior: relationship of
the mandible to the maxilla.
2. Premature contacts in retruded contact
position.
3. Lack of occlusal balance in: eccentric
mandibular positions
www.indiandentalacademy.com
112. 4. Vertical dimension excessive and therefore
inadequate freeway space and interference
with speaking space.
5. Cramped tongue space a teeth set too far
lingually.
6. Inadequate periphery leading to poor
retention and failure to restore lips and
cheeks to the pre-extraction form.
7. Under extended denture bases.
8. Failure to recognize design of existing
dentures
